Can I Legally Drive Over Speed Limits in Medical Emergencies?

Driving over speed limits in medical emergencies is a complex topic that involves a balance between public safety, the urgency of the situation, and adherence to traffic laws. This overview aims to provide an in-depth analysis of the legal implications and ethical considerations surrounding this issue.

The Importance of Adhering to Speed Limits:

Speed limits are established to ensure the safety of all road users, prevent accidents, and maintain traffic flow. Excessive speed can lead to reduced reaction times, impaired vehicle control, and increased accident risks. These regulations are designed to safeguard individuals and the community as a whole.

Emergency Services and Exemptions: Can I Legally Drive Over Speed Limits in Medical Emergencies? 

In most jurisdictions, emergency service vehicles (ambulances, police cars, fire trucks) are granted exemptions to speed limits while responding to emergencies. This is based on the understanding that the benefits of rapid response outweigh the risks associated with exceeding speed limits. However, the privileges granted to emergency vehicles do not extend to private citizens.

Legal Implications for Private Citizens:

While the urgency of a medical situation is unquestionable, the law typically does not provide a blanket exemption for private citizens to drive over speed limits in medical emergencies. The rationale behind this approach is to maintain order on the roads and minimize the potential for accidents caused by reckless driving, even in dire situations.

Some jurisdictions have enacted “Good Samaritan” laws that offer legal protection to individuals who provide assistance in emergencies, including medical situations. However, these laws generally do not grant permission to violate traffic laws. While helping someone in need is encouraged, it does not necessarily mean a free pass to exceed speed limits.

Managing Medical Emergencies While Adhering to Driving Speed Limits: Exploring Alternative Options

In the event of a medical emergency, the need for timely intervention is paramount. However, adhering to driving speed limits is crucial for ensuring road safety and preventing accidents. While the urgency of the situation may tempt drivers to exceed the speed limit, it’s essential to explore alternative options that balance the need for prompt medical care with responsible driving practices. This article delves into seven alternative options for managing medical emergencies while complying with driving speed limits.

Option 1: Call for Professional Help: 

One of the most effective alternatives is to call for professional medical assistance. Dialing emergency services, such as 911 or local medical hotlines, connects you with trained responders who can dispatch ambulances or paramedics to the scene. These professionals are equipped with the necessary medical equipment to provide immediate care, reducing the need for you to drive hastily.

Option 2: Delegate Driving Responsibilities

If you’re traveling with someone else, delegate the driving responsibilities to a capable individual. This could be a friend, family member, or even a bystander willing to help. Passengers can drive safely within speed limits, allowing you to focus on the patient’s needs without compromising road safety.

Option 3: Utilize Rideshare Services

Rideshare services, like Uber or Lyft, are widely available in many regions. In non-life-threatening situations, these services can quickly transport you and the patient to a medical facility. Drivers are well-versed in local traffic conditions and can navigate through the city efficiently, adhering to speed limits.

Option 4: Arrange for Medical Escort Services

Some medical facilities offer medical escort services, where trained professionals accompany patients during transportation. These escorts can administer first aid and monitor the patient’s condition en route, ensuring their safety while adhering to traffic regulations.

Option 5: Plan Your Route Ahead

In emergencies, pre-planning your route can make a significant difference. Familiarize yourself with alternative routes that might have fewer traffic congestions. This can help you reach the medical facility in a timely manner while staying within speed limits.

Option 6: Consider Telemedicine Consultations

Advancements in technology have made telemedicine consultations increasingly accessible. In certain medical emergencies, consulting a healthcare professional remotely can provide initial guidance and recommendations. This can buy you time to reach the hospital or clinic without compromising safety.

Option 7: Basic First Aid and Stabilization

For less severe medical emergencies, administering basic first aid and stabilization techniques can be crucial. This can help stabilize the patient’s condition until professional medical help arrives. However, it’s important to know your limitations and when to seek expert medical care.
